Job Openings >> Application Developer
Application Developer
Summary
Title:Application Developer
ID:1468
Department:Information Technology
Description

Shedd aquarium’s technology team is looking to add an application developer to our small, cross-functional team.  The Application Developer role is responsible for the development, implementation and maintenance of custom and delivered software, including sheddaquarium.org, developed in support of Shedd’s mission to spark compassion, curiosity and conservation for the aquatic animal world.

This individual works closely with the Director of Application Development, Senior Application Developers, and other team members to develop new products, features, and enhancements as well as troubleshoot software. The Application Developer will help develop recommendations on the use of new and emerging technologies where appropriate.

Duties & Responsibilities:

  • Demonstrate commitment to Shedd’s vision, mission, and values.  
  • Develop/Maintain in-house custom and third party developed/packaged applications.
  • Develop/Maintain reports to support business operations.
  • Attend operational meetings as necessary.
  • Clearly and effectively communicate project status, progress, and/or delays.
  • Engage in unconventional thinking/creative problem solving to address client needs and provide high-value service.
  • Alert colleagues to emerging technologies or applications and the opportunities to integrate them into operations and activities.
  • Develop innovative, reusable technology tools.
  • Learn/Code in different languages/frameworks as necessary.
  • Write test cases, unit tests, regression tests.
  • Assess the advantages and disadvantages of new frameworks and technologies.
  • Identify inefficiencies and offer innovative solutions.
  • Perform other duties as assigned.

Qualifications:

Education:

  • Bachelor’s degree in Computer Science or a related field is preferred
  • Equivalent combination of education, training and experience would be accepted in lieu of a degree

Experience:  
Minimum of 3 years’ experience in design, development, and support of custom and packaged software. Experience with the following is required:

  • Ruby/Ruby on Rails
  • React
  • Automated tests/rspec
  • HTML/HTML5/CSS/XHTML
  • Javascript/JQuery
  • Docker
  • PostgreSQL/PL/pgSQL
  • Git/GitHub
  • REST APIs
  • Experience with the .NET framework and C#.

Preferred/Beneficial to have:

  • SQL/T-SQL – scripting, stored procedures, custom views, tables, SSRS
  • Android/iOS programming
  • Tessitura
  • Sass or other CSS pre-processor

We strongly encourage people of color, LGBTQ+ community, veterans and active duty military, parents, individuals with disabilities, and individuals from all cultural backgrounds to apply. Shedd Aquarium is an equal opportunity employer and welcomes everyone to our team.

If you need a reasonable accommodation at any point in the application or interview process, please let us know. In your application, please feel free to select which pronouns you use (For example – she/her/hers, he/him/his, they/them/theirs).

This opening is closed and is no longer accepting applications
ApplicantStack powered by Swipeclock